Internally, isdnctrl.c contains a list of functions (defs_fcns []), which
are called one after the other with the interface-name as a patameter.
Each function returns a char* to a string containing iscnctrl-commands
to be executed. Example:
char *
defs_budget(char *id) {
static char r [1024];
char *p = r;
p += sprintf(p, "budget %s dial 10 1min\n", id);
p += sprintf(p, "budget %s charge 100 1day\n", id);
p += sprintf(p, "budget %s online 8hour 1day\n", id);
return(r);
}
The advantage of this approach is, that even complex commands can be executed.
